Purdy Lane Comm & Gas Station: frequently asked questions

Is Purdy Lane Comm & Gas Station's water safe to drink?

Purdy Lane Comm & Gas Station is an active transient non-community water system regulated under the Safe Drinking Water Act, overseen by the WA state drinking water program. EPA SDWA violation and enforcement records for this system are being added to AquaCensus from EPA ECHO; consult EPA ECHO or your annual Consumer Confidence Report for its current compliance status.

Who runs Purdy Lane Comm & Gas Station?

Purdy Lane Comm & Gas Station (PWSID WA5305802) is a private-owned transient non-community water system, regulated by the WA state drinking water program.

How many people does Purdy Lane Comm & Gas Station serve?

Purdy Lane Comm & Gas Station reports serving 25 people through 5 service connections in Pierce County, Washington.

Where does Purdy Lane Comm & Gas Station get its water?

EPA SDWIS lists this system's primary water source as groundwater.
